The Impact of Volkswagen's Restructuring
Volkswagen (VW) recently announced an extensive restructuring plan intended to streamline its operations and improve profitability across its brands. This strategic overhaul is a response to shifting market dynamics, including increased competition and a pronounced pivot towards electric vehicles (EVs). However, Skoda Auto, a subsidiary of VW, has publicly stated that it will not face direct repercussions from these changes.
As VW undertakes this transformative initiative, Skoda Auto is maintaining its trajectory, focusing on enhancing its product line and expanding its market presence, particularly in regions like Southeast Asia. This commitment to stability is crucial, especially as global automotive markets undergo significant transformation.
Skoda’s Strategic Focus
While VW reconfigures its business model, Skoda is ramping up its efforts in several key areas:
1. Embracing Electric Mobility
Skoda has been investing heavily in electric mobility. The company is set to introduce several EV models in the coming years, aligning with global trends towards sustainable transportation. This aligns with the increased interest in electric vehicles in markets such as Indonesia, where consumers are becoming more environmentally conscious.
2. Expanding Global Footprint
Skoda is not only focusing on its European base but also looking to expand its reach in emerging markets like ASEAN. Countries such as Indonesia and Thailand present lucrative opportunities due to rising incomes and a growing middle class interested in modern automotive technology.
3. Strengthening Customer Relations
To enhance customer loyalty, Skoda is enhancing its service offerings and digital experiences. By focusing on customer feedback and preferences, the brand aims to create a seamless buying experience, catering to both traditional and tech-savvy consumers.
